THE PROBLEM SOLVING PROCESS Identify the area of concern. Analyze the problem (assess). Identify a specific problem. Set a measurable goal. Develop interventions to meet the goal. Implement the interventions. Provide support. Monitor progress. Evaluate the success of the intervention.

BUILDING LEVEL TEAMS:
Support grade level teams Help organize and sort data for alike or grade
level teams Help set building level data goals Oversee the movement of children between
tiers Set building procedures for looking at and
using data
GRADE LEVEL OR TEACHER ALIKE DATA TEAMING
Teams of like teachers working together to…
Access critical data on all students’ performance related to achievement of standards
Analyze data and find which students have which gaps in attainments
Set measurable goals to close the gap Identify and implement research-based
instructional strategies
TEACHERS WORKING TOGETHER
Like teachers = grade level or department level
Use of collaborative skills (e.g., problem solving process, identify research-based strategies.)
Need a structure (time, place, etc.)

BEFORE THE MEETING: Data are prepared for the meeting in a
teacher-friendly format Data are sent to teachers in advance Principal decides who is permanent session
facilitator Principal assigns a scribe at each meeting Time keeper role: How much time is allocated
for the meeting? How are we doing in getting through the agenda?
Summarizer? Principal arranges for meeting logistics
BEFORE THE MEETING
Provide written prompts for teachers to use when looking at data before the meeting
Provide written prompts for teachers to think about what they are doing now
Data sets in question
DURING THE MEETING:
1. Team accesses district-provided data sets2. Team identifies current performance of grade
level 3. Team sets measurable goal (s)4. Team identifies research-based instructional
strategies5. Team analyzes suggested strategies6. Team selects and agrees to implement
strategies7. Team plans logistics of strategy implementation8. Team identifies which students will need more
frequent assessment9. Team sets next meeting date
AFTER THE MEETING:
Follow up with intervention plan and monitoring plan
Prepare data for next meeting
